About Schools in Stevensville, Montana

Stevensville, Montana is home to 5 schools, including 5 public schools. The city's schools span 2 elementary schools, 2 middle schools, and 1 high school.

With an average rating of 5.3 out of 10, schools in Stevensville show moderate performance on the MySchoolScout composite scale, which blends student growth, poverty-adjusted academic achievement, and school environment — plus college readiness for high schools.

The highest-performing school in Stevensville is Lone Rock School with a composite score of 8.0/10, demonstrating strong academic outcomes and school quality metrics.

Stevensville is served by 3 school districts: Lone Rock Elem, Stevensville Elem, Stevensville H S. These districts collectively serve 1,285 students.

Stevensville's community shows 29% bachelor's degree attainment with a median household income of $80,389. The poverty rate in the area is 7.5%.

Community Profile

Stevensville has a median household income of $80,389. It is an area where 29%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$465,800, with a median rent of $1,082/month. The local poverty rate of 7.5% is relatively low. The average commute in the area is 36 minutes, which is above the national average.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.

How does MySchoolScout rate schools in Stevensville, Montana?

MySchoolScout rates schools using publicly available data from the NCES Common Core of Data and state education departments. Each school receives a 1-10 composite score built from Student Growth, Poverty-Adjusted Academic Achievement, and School Environment — plus College Readiness for high schools. Weights vary by school level, and equity data is shown for context but not scored.
